Yes, BNSF Railway offers a comprehensive range of intermodal services. Intermodal transportation involves the use of multiple modes of transport, most often combining rail and truck services, to move freight more efficiently and effectively. BNSF Railway integrates its extensive rail network with a robust truck transportation system, allowing for the seamless movement of goods across long distances.
BNSF's intermodal services are designed to accommodate various types of freight, including consumer goods, automobiles, and agricultural products. They have strategically located intermodal terminals across the United States, which enhances their ability to handle a diverse range of shipping needs. The railway company is also known for its investment in technology that improves service reliability and tracking capabilities, giving customers real-time visibility to their shipments.
